Odebrecht Finance misses interest payment on 4 3/8% notes due 2025

By Marisa Wong

Morgantown, W.Va., Nov. 6 – Odebrecht Finance Ltd. failed to make an interest payment on its $550 million 4 3/8% senior notes due 2025, according to a notice of default.

The coupon payment was due Oct. 25, but as of that day funds had not been received by the paying agent or trustee for the notes.

An event of default will occur if the failure to pay continues for a period of 30 days, according to the notice.

Bank of New York Mellon is the trustee.

The issuer is a Cayman Islands-based subsidiary of Odebrecht Engenharia e Construcao SA, a construction engineering company based in Rio de Janeiro.
